  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Pip, as a Chihuahua, typically thrives in a home that offers a warm and loving environment. He can adapt to apartment living as long as he gets daily walks and playtime.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    This small breed, like Pip, doesn't require a large outdoor space. A small yard or regular trips to the park for playtime will keep him happy.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Pip can be suitable for homes with children, especially if they understand boundaries and know how to interact gently with a cautious dog.
